Abstract
When a cube has been selected, and a touch operation has been canceled, a retouch determination area that is larger than the original selection area for selecting the cube is set based on a touch cancellation position. When a retouch operation has been detected within the retouch determination area after the touch operation has been canceled, it is determined that the same position as the touch cancellation position has been retouched, and the cube (object) is moved.
